Preparing the Site: Key Steps

Effective site preparation is essential for a successful concrete installation process. Initially, the area must be cleared of debris, vegetation, and any existing structures. This step provides a clean, stable foundation. Following this, the soil is evaluated for compaction and drainage capabilities; if necessary, it may be compacted or treated to increase st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also necessary, as they define the shape and dimensions of the concrete pour. Lastly, reinforcing materials, such as rebar or wire mesh, are positioned to strengthen the concrete's strength. Proper execution of these steps lays the groundwork for a durable and reliable concrete structure.

Why the Curing Process Matters

Despite being often ignored, the curing process plays an essential role in the success of a concrete installation. This phase initiates promptly once the concrete is poured and necessitates sustaining adequate moisture, temperature, and time to allow the concrete to achieve its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include covering the surface with wet burlap, using curing compounds, or applying plastic sheeting to keep moisture in. Typically, the curing period spans from a few days to several weeks, according to environmental conditions and the specific concrete mix used. Understanding the significance of this process guarantees that the final structure remains stable and lasting, meeting the expectations of clients.

Consistent Cleaning Techniques

Routine cleaning procedures are vital for sustaining the long-term condition and aesthetics of concrete surfaces. Regular upkeep, such as eliminating debris and dirt, works to stop staining and deterioration. Power cleaning efficiently eliminates stubborn marks, algae, or moss that may gather over time. It is suggested to use a soft cleanser during this process to minimize chemical damage. Furthermore, promptly addressing spills, specifically from oil or chemicals, can stop permanent discoloration. In cold weather regions, taking away snow and ice is critical to inhibit cracking due to freeze-thaw cycles. Routine checks for cracks or surface wear can also support identifying issues early, guaranteeing that concrete surfaces remain durable and visually appealing for years to come.

How Often to Apply Sealant

Normally, putting on a sealant to concrete surfaces every 1-3 years is vital for upholding their structural integrity and visual appeal. This schedule varies with factors such as weather conditions, foot traffic, and the type of sealant used. Periodic inspections can aid in establishing when reapplication is necessary; symptoms like discoloration, wear, or water penetration reveal that the sealant has deteriorated. Homeowners should choose premium sealants designed for their specific concrete applications, ensuring better durability. Additionally, proper surface preparation before application enhances adhesion and effectiveness. By sticking to this maintenance schedule, property owners can safeguard their concrete investments, lengthening the lifespan of surfaces and reducing costly repairs in the future.

Future Trends and Innovations in Advanced Concrete Methods

How is the concrete field transforming to satisfy the requirements of a fast-paced changing environment? Breakthroughs in concrete technology are forming a more eco-friendly and resilient future. Researchers are designing sustainable alternatives, such as recycled aggregates and bio-based additives, which decrease the carbon footprint of concrete production. Furthermore, developments in smart concrete—incorporating sensors that monitor structural health—facilitate proactive maintenance, improving safety and resilience.

Another growing trend is the use of 3D printing tech, enabling rapid construction of intricate structures with limited waste. Moreover, self-healing concrete, which employs bacteria or alternative materials to repair cracks automatically, is attracting momentum, promising extended-life infrastructure systems.

With growing urbanization and climate change affecting construction methods, these see this article advancements showcase the industry's devotion to sustainability and efficiency. The future of concrete technology offers significant promise for transforming how society builds, guaranteeing structures that are long-lasting and ecologically responsible.

How Long Does Concrete Typically Take to Cure Completely?

Concrete typically takes about 28 days to cure completely, although initial hardening takes place within hours. Conditions such as temperature, humidity, and mix design can alter the curing process and overall strength development.

What Concrete Finish Options Are Available?

Various concrete finishes feature polished, stamped, exposed aggregate, brushed, and troweled. Every single finish features specific aesthetics and textures, catering to various design preferences and functional requirements in residential and commercial applications.

Can Concrete Be Poured in Cold Weather?

Indeed, concrete can be installed in cold weather, but certain precautions are required. Correct techniques and materials, such as heated water and insulating blankets, help make certain the concrete cures successfully despite lower temperatures.

What's the Best Course of Action if My Concrete Cracks?

Should concrete crack, examine the scope of the damage. Minor damage can be repaired with a concrete patching compound, while larger cracks might need professional evaluation and repair to preserve structural integrity and prevent more deterioration.

How Can I Determine if My Concrete Needs Resurfacing?

To assess whether concrete needs resurfacing, it's important to look for visible cracks, uneven surfaces, or discoloration. Additionally, pooling water or a rough texture can demonstrate that resurfacing is essential for better aesthetics and functionality.
